11. Cyclotides : Tuning Parameters Toward Their Use in Drug Design
Abstract : Cyclotides are plant proteins with a unique topology, defined as the cyclic cystine knot motif. The motif endows cyclotides with exceptional chemical and biological stability. 14. NMR studies of DNA structure and counterion behaviour
Abstract : DNA is a polymer of nucleotides, each nucleotide consisting of a negatively charged phosphate group, a ribose sugar unit, and a purine or pyrimidine base. The secondary structure of DNA is commonly a double-helix with Watson-Crick paired bases. Several secondary structures, all with these features, are observed for DNA. READ MORE

15. Palaeoenvironmental reconstructions from modern and ancient plant DNA
Abstract : Palaeoecological studies on lake sediments and peat archives have provided fundamental knowledge about past environments, nevertheless, a lot remains to be learned. In this thesis, I focussed on plant ancient DNA extracted from sedimentary archives (sedaDNA), in combination with DNA from living trees with the aims of: (1) investigating different extraction methods and levels of inhibition in sediments, (2) investigating postglacial recolonisation history of Norway spruce in Fennoscandia, (3) comparing different sequencing and bioinformatic approaches to investigate past flora changes using sedaDNA and investigating past flora change in contrasting environments (southern Italy versus southern Sweden), and (4) communicating my work more broadly using art.
